We are seeking a Structural Engineer to join our engineering team. This role is responsible for designing, analyzing, and evaluating structural systems for commercial, industrial, and manufacturing projects. The ideal candidate has strong technical expertise, excellent problem-solving skills, and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ver safe, cost-effective, and code-compliant solutions.
Responsibilities
Design and analyze steel, concrete, masonry, timber, and foundation systems.
Prepare structural calculations, engineering reports, specifications, and construction drawings.
Develop structural designs that meet applicable building codes, safety regulations, and project requirements.
Coordinate with architects, civil engineers, mechanical/electrical engineers, contractors, and project managers throughout the project lifecycle.
Perform structural assessments, inspections, and evaluations of existing buildings and infrastructure.
Review shop drawings, RFIs, submittals, and change orders.
Support construction activities by responding to technical questions and conducting site visits as needed.
Identify design risks and recommend practical, cost-effective solutions.
Utilize structural analysis software to model and evaluate structural performance.
Ensure projects are completed on schedule, within budget, and in compliance with quality standards.
Maintain thorough project documentation and engineering records.
Requirements
achelor's degree in Civil Engineering with an emphasis in Structural Engineering.
3+ years of structural engineering experience (level may vary based on role).
Professional Engineer (PE) license preferred or ability to obtain.
Strong knowledge of IBC, ASCE, AISC, ACI, and other applicable design codes.
Experience designing structural systems for commercial, industrial, or manufacturing facilities.
Proficiency with structural analysis and design software such as RISA, STAAD.Pro, SAP2000, ETABS, RAM Structural System, or similar platforms.
Experience with AutoCAD and/or Revit preferred.
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ines.
